Dear all,
my name is Peter and I´m from Germany.

I´m restoring an old Hadley vacuum driven compressor of the system of my car, which is not a Cadillac, but Cadillac used the pumps in their ALC systems in the '70's.   

More or less the O-rings I have found here in Germany in a shop speciallized for such things.
The gasket made out of cork of the front cover I have organized a reproduction. We had the original one digitalized and now a small series of 10 pieces has been produced. I had the choice either to get it in cork or made out of rubber. I decided to have the first ten in rubber.

But now the biggest problem is the diaphragm respectively the membrane of the compressor. This is difficult to have it reproduced because it is not just a plain mebrane.

Due to the fact that I could not find any spare parts here in Germany I started to search in the Internet.

So my concern now is if anyone here knows a source for such parts.
I contacted already Hadley customer service Europe but they said there are no parts available anymore.
Hadley US I´m still waiting for an answer but I must admit I do not hope that they will be able to help.

Maybe there is someone in the US who has started a reproduction.

I´m looking forward to any answer and suggestion from the members of this Forum.

Glen

Quote from: 67 Cadillac on December 19, 2019, 12:13:06 AM
Is that correct. The compressor is always running when the engine is running?  If this is the case then we have fixed it. I thought that it got to a maximum pressure and stopped. That would be great. One less thing to fix.

Thanks
Jeff

No, the pump gets a constant supply of vacuum, but when the reservoir gets up to pressure (about 280 psi) the pump stalls.  That is the point at which the vacuum acting on the diaphragm can no longer move the piston against the pressure in the tank. 
That means the pump does not run at low vacuum like when driving at speed or when accelerating.  When running properly it only runs when the engine is at idle.
